Psychic Roots
Serendipity and Intuition in Genealogy

Henry Z Jones, Jr.

Psychic Roots is all about the influence of coincidence and serendipity on genealogical research, the chance combination of events over which the researcher has no control but which nevertheless guides him to a fortuitous discovery. Certainly chance or dumb luck sometimes leads us straight to a record kept in an improbable place, to an ancestor's second wife we didn't know anything about, and so on. Is it luck? Coincidence? In this book, esteemed genealogist Hank Jones tells us about his own brushes with preternatural experiences, and he has invited other genealogists to share their experiences as well; thus in these pages we have the insights of well over a hundred respected ancestor hunters who discuss their experiences in light of synchronicity, intuition, genetic memory, and serendipity. Their stories fairly crackle with illumination and make a plausible case for the importance of the sixth sense in genealogical research.

EDITORIAL REVIEWS

"A highly enjoyable book that most genealogists will want to read and talk about."--THE NEW YORK GENEALOGICAL AND BIOGRAPHICAL RECORD, Vol. 125, No. 1 (January 1994), p. 54.

"While 'doubting Thomases' may see a few of these stories as cliched or mundane...other readers..,will find them a meaningful validation of their own experiences."--THE NEW ENGLAND HISTORICAL AND GENEALOGICAL REGISTER, Vol. 151, (July 1997), p. 378.

"Psychic Roots puts us in touch with other genealogists and, for a moment, we share with them reactions and responses to genealogical research."--FEDERATION OF GENEALOGICAL SOCIETIES FORUM, Vol. 5, No. 4 (Winter 1993), pp. 26-27.
